Southern Miss President Rodney Bennett donates $72,630 raise to scholarship fund

Rodney Bennett, University of Southern Mississippi president, has donated a recent raise he received to a scholarship fund at the university.

The Mississippi Institutions of Higher Learning gave Bennett a $72,630 raise, increasing his salary to $464,500 a year. But in a July 6 email to the campus community, Bennett said he wouldn't keep that hike.

"I am sensitive this increase comes at a time when so many employees have not received pay increases, have had positions eliminated or have had positions in their units unfilled," he wrote. "As such, I have decided to use this salary increase to endow a second scholarship through the USM Foundation."

Southern Miss cut personnel in May after receiving $7.96 million less in funding since fiscal year 2017. Three employees lost their jobs. Another 33 vacant positions were eliminated.

"The scholarship will assist students in attending and completing their education at USM, something for which I feel a strong conviction," Bennett said.
